Human Body Assistant
Position involves interacting with the public and assisting in the explanation of interactive exhibits.
Duties:
Interact with the public in a courteous and friendly manner by encouraging them to experience aspects of the exhibits and by answering their questions; provide explanations of the activities in the exhibit area.
Skills:
Comfort in front of an audience; ability to deal with the public in a friendly and courteous manner; willing to assist in the maintenance of interactive exhibits; interest in working with audiovisual equipment and the Internet; knowledge and/or interest in space and health sciences.
Training:
Provided by the Human Body staff.
